Craig M. Johnson

Craig M. Johnson, 85, passed away at 7:12 pm Wednesday, June 25, 2025, at OSF St. Francis Medical Center Peoria, Illinois.

Craig was born on December 13, 1939, in Elgin, Illinois, the son of Hilding and Lucile (Larson) Johnson. He graduated from Galesburg High School in1957 and earned his bachelor’s degree from MacMurray College in 1961.

Craig married Marcia L. Callahan on January 3, 1965, in Galesburg and together expanded their family to a family of five welcoming children, Eric, Preston, Kimberly, Christine and Shannon.

Craig owned and operated Galesburg Electric for over 50 years. He believed community involvement was very important. He was a member of the First United Methodist Church. Craig volunteered for the Galesburg High School Booster Club as well as the Carl Sandburg College Booster Club. He enjoyed coaching numerous athletic teams in the area and served on the Athletic Hall of Fame Committee for Galesburg High School. Craig had a love for singing and participated in many Choral Dynamics productions. Craig also had a passion for playing a match of tennis in his free time.

Craig and Marcia were great supporters of all things basketball in the Galesburg area. So much that they constructed a full court basketball court in their backyard, installing lights for kids to have the opportunity to play basketball at all hours. Making it an inviting and safe place for neighborhood kids to hang out.

Craig is survived by his wife of sixty years, Marcia; his children, Eric (Katrina) Johnson, Preston Johnson, and Kimberly (Charles) Lunsford all of Galesburg and Shannon (fiancé Stephen Nowak) Johnson of Glenview, Illinois; his sister, Barbara (Tobbe) Wangelid of Galesburg and four grandchildren, Kendall Johnson, Katyn (fiancé Austin Price) Pica-Johnson, Audrey Johnson and Jesse Lunsford. He is preceded in death by his daughter, Christine in 1973 and his parents.
